探索工业自动化的基石:IEC 61131-3 中文版

探索工业自动化的基石:IEC 61131-3 中文版

【下载地址】可编程语言标准IEC61131-3中文版 - **文件名**: 可编程语言标准IEC61131-3中文版.pdf- **描述**: 此文档为IEC 61131-3标准的完整中文翻译版本,旨在帮助中文读者深入理解并应用这一标准。对于从事工业自动化、PLC编程设计的研发人员、工程师及学习相关领域的学生来说,它是不可或缺的学习和参考工具 【下载地址】可编程语言标准IEC61131-3中文版 项目地址: https://gitcode.com/Open-source-documentation-tutorial/95575

项目介绍

在工业自动化的世界里,标准是推动技术进步和系统集成的重要基石。IEC 61131-3 作为国际电工委员会(International Electrotechnical Commission)发布的一项关键标准,为可编程控制器(PLCs)的编程语言提供了统一的框架。本项目提供了 IEC 61131-3 中文版 的完整翻译,旨在帮助中文读者深入理解和应用这一标准。无论您是工业自动化领域的研发人员、工程师,还是相关专业的学生,这份资源都将成为您不可或缺的学习和参考工具。

项目技术分析

IEC 61131-3 标准定义了五种结构化编程语言:

  1. 梯形图(Ladder Diagram, LD):直观易懂,适合电气工程师使用。
  2. 指令列表(Instruction List, IL):类似于汇编语言,适合需要精细控制的场景。
  3. 功能块图(Function Block Diagram, FBD):模块化设计,便于复杂系统的构建。
  4. 顺序功能图(Sequential Function Chart, SFC):适用于流程控制,清晰展示系统状态转换。
  5. 结构文本(Structured Text, ST):类似于高级编程语言,适合复杂算法和数据处理。

这些语言的统一标准不仅提高了程序的可读性和可靠性,还大大简化了不同背景技术人员之间的沟通与协作。

项目及技术应用场景

IEC 61131-3 标准广泛应用于各种工业自动化场景,包括但不限于:

  • 制造业:生产线自动化控制,提高生产效率和产品质量。
  • 能源行业:电力系统监控与控制,确保系统稳定运行。
  • 交通运输:交通信号控制,优化交通流量。
  • 楼宇自动化:智能楼宇管理系统,提升能源利用效率。

无论是大型工业项目还是小型控制系统,IEC 61131-3 标准都能提供强大的技术支持,帮助开发者优化控制系统设计,减少开发周期,提升系统性能。

项目特点

  • 统一标准理解:提供了一套标准化的语言框架,便于不同背景的技术人员进行有效的沟通与协作。
  • 技术规范明确:明确规定了每种编程语言的语法和语义,有助于提高程序的可读性、可靠性和可维护性。
  • 丰富的学习资源:对于初学者,此中文版标准是入门工业自动化的宝贵资料,能加速理解和掌握PLC编程的核心概念。
  • 实践经验指导:专业人士可通过理解和遵循标准,优化控制系统的设计,减少开发周期,提升系统性能。

结语

掌握 IEC 61131-3 标准不仅能够提升个人的专业能力,更是推动工业自动化进程的重要一步。通过这份中文版资源,希望更多国内开发者和技术人员能够无障碍地接触和应用国际先进的编程规范,共同促进工业4.0的发展。请合理使用该文档,尊重知识产权,支持正版,鼓励官方渠道购买以获取更新和支持。

【下载地址】可编程语言标准IEC61131-3中文版 - **文件名**: 可编程语言标准IEC61131-3中文版.pdf- **描述**: 此文档为IEC 61131-3标准的完整中文翻译版本,旨在帮助中文读者深入理解并应用这一标准。对于从事工业自动化、PLC编程设计的研发人员、工程师及学习相关领域的学生来说,它是不可或缺的学习和参考工具 【下载地址】可编程语言标准IEC61131-3中文版 项目地址: https://gitcode.com/Open-source-documentation-tutorial/95575

IEC 61131-3标准包括两部分:编程和变量。编程部分描述了两个重要模型:IEC 软件模型和通讯模型。变量定义了编程系统中需要的的数据类型。 IEC61131-3是当今世界第一个为工业自动化控制系统的软件设计提供标准化编程语言 的国际标准。此前,国际上没有出现过有实际意义、为制定通用的控制语言而开展的标准化 活动。这显然是注意到由于DCS等以数字技术为基础的控制装置在发展进程中过于专有化,给用户带来的大量不便。这个标准将现代软件的概念和现代软件工程的机制与传统的PLC编程语言成功地结合,又对当代种类繁多的工业控制器中的编程概念及语言进行了标准化。它为可编程控制器软件技术的发展,乃至整个工业控制软件技术的发展,起着举足轻重的推动作用。可以说,没有编程语言的标准化便没有今天 PLC走向开放式系统的坚实基础。为了使标准的规定适用于广泛的应用范围,又能为 PLC制造厂商所接受和支持,IEC61131-3规定了二大类编程语言即文本化编程语言和图形化编程语言。前者包括指令清单语 言(IL)和结构化文本语言(ST);后者则有梯形图语言(LD)和功能块图语言(FBD)。在 标准的文本中没有把顺序功能图(SFC)单独列入编程语言,而是将它在公用元素中予以规范。这就是说,不论在文本化语言中,或者在图形化语言中,都可以运用 SFC的概念、句法 和语法。但习惯上也把它叫做另一种编程语言。 这五种编程语言都是依据工业控制的基本元器件及由其构成的网络或电路,采用某种在计算机上仿真它们的工作原理和功能而形成的。梯形图(LD)语言是将并行动作的机电元件(诸如继电器触点和线圈、定时器、计数器等)网络加以模型化。功能块图(FBD)语言 则是将并行动作的电子元件(诸如加法器、乘法器、移位寄存器、逻辑运算门等)的网络予以模型化。而结构化文本(ST)语言将典型的信息处理任务(如在通用的高级语言 Pascal 中的使用数值算法)予以模型化。指令表(IL)语言却是将汇编语言中控制系统的低层编程 予以模型化。顺序功能图(SFCs)将时间驱动和事件驱动的顺序控制设备和算法模型化。 值得注意的是,IEC 61131-3 允许在同一个 PLC中使用多种编程语言,允许程序开发人员对每一个特定的任务选择最合适的编程语言,还允许在同一个控制程序中其不同的程序模 块用不同的编程语言编制。这些规定妥善继承了 PLC发展历史中形成的编程语言多样化的现实,又为 PLC软件技术的进一步发展提供了足够的空间。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

尚谦骏

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值